Digimon Tamers[edit]
- Voice Actor:
Tada Aoi |
Mona Marshall
Gummymon is the Partner Digimon of Lee Jianliang. Terriermon reduced to this form when he was forced to return to the Digital World.

Digimon Story: Sunburst & Moonlight[edit]
Gummymon is an obtainable Digimon. It can be scanned in Chip Forest. It can evolve into Terriermon, Bakumon, or Renamon.

Digimon Story: Lost Evolution[edit]
Gummymon is an obtainable Digimon. It can be scanned in Chip Forest. It can evolve into Terriermon or Armadimon.
